Halftone
Process using a series of dots of various sizes within a fixed grid to simulate shades of grade.

Halo
Lightening of black ink when it is printed near another colour.

Head Crash
Accidental contact of an inkjet nozzle or the complete head with a substrate during printing.

Hexachrome
A colour matching system that allows the combination of 6 colours (CMYK, orange and green) in order to reproduce a larger gamut of colours; developed by Pantone Inc.

Hi-Fi
6-colour printing used to obtain a more subtle rendition of light tones beyond that of traditional 4-colour processes by adding light cyan and light magenta.

Hot Lamination
Application of a clear layer to protect a print or other substrate; may contain UV-filters; uses heat to activate the adhesive and thus cannot be used on heat sensitive substrates. Prints must be completely dry before lamination to avoid bubbles due to trapped moisture.

HSV
Hue, Saturation and Value; a colour model in which colour is described in terms of chromatic colour, its intensity and its variation from light to dark.

Hue
One of the components of colour represented by angle of a 360° colour wheel.

Humectant
Soluble component of inkjet inks that is used to preserve the moisture content of the inks.
